@Daniel Gabor if youโ€™re allowed to have them where you live itโ€™s pretty easy. Just make sure they have a structure to get out of the elements and feed them hay, with a side of free choice minerals and baking soda. Keep up with parasite loads and trimming hooves. Pretty easy
